AFTER NICOLAS SANSON (FRENCH, 1600-1667) MAP OF FLORIDA, hand-colored engraving on laid paper, titled "LA FLORIDE / Par N. Sanson / d'. Abbeville / Geogr Ordre. du Roy" in cartouche along lower center edge, depicting Florida and Southeastern area of North America along the Gulf of Mexico, featuring "Virginie" in the upper right corner with "L. Erie" to the upper left next to it, Canada along the top edge, "Nouveau Mexique" along the left side. Housed under UV glass in a modern gilt frame, backing paper with gallery label for Antique Prints, Inc. of Ocean View, DE. 18th century. 10" x 7" sight, 16" x 12 1/2" OA.
Condition
Very good visual condition with vertical fold lines, light ghosting from being folded, two areas of staining along the top edge, some light spotting, frame with minor wear. Not examined out of frame. Â
